Florida Gambling Laws Overview

Florida allows tribal casinos, pari-mutuel race track casinos (racinos), lotteries, and charity games. These are regulated under both state and federal laws. Land-based and online sports betting is not legal in the state. In fact, no online gambling is permitted but this may change in the near future as there are plans for Florida online casino sites and FL gambling sites to emerge.

Plans for online sports betting in Florida

Sen Jeff Brandes wants to legalize sports betting in Florida and filed a legislative proposal near the end of 2020: SB 392: Sports Wagering. Under this proposal, sports betting would be authorized and regulated online and at lottery kiosks, falling under the Florida Lottery.

There has been historical resistance from the Seminole Tribe, who believe they were given exclusive rights to all Class III gambling forms. Negotiations are ongoing.

Lotteries

After a state lottery began operating in 1988, it began selling scratch-off tickets and statewide prize draw tickets. The Florida Lottery joined the Multi-State Lottery Association in July 2008, where it started selling interstate Powerball and Mega Millions tickets in May 2013. Tickets can be purchased legally at one of over 13,000 lottery retailers located across the state. Over 60 scratch-off tickets can be purchased from these retailers.

Social Gaming

Section 849.14, F.S., prohibits fantasy sports leagues from accepting entrance fees. The state considers that DFS, which rewards money, is a form of gambling but has not created laws to regulate it. Fantasy websites, including DraftKings and FanDuel, have not been deterred from accepting Florida players in the way online casino gambling has been restricted.

Horse Racing and Pari-Mutuel

Off-track and inter-track horse racing, harness horse racing, jai alai, and cardroom poker is permitted at pari-mutuel facilities. In Miami-Dade and Broward, pari-mutuel facilities are also authorized to offer slot machines as an option.

For years, greyhound racing was also legal in Florida, but that came to an end with the close of 2020 after Florida voters chose to end the practice. Greyhound racing has been on the decline for decades.

Land-Based Casinos in Florida

The Seminoles are a federally recognized Indian tribe that owns and operates 6 Florida tribal casinos. Additionally, the Miccosukee tribe operates one casino. These Florida state tribal casinos offer hundreds of slot machines, high-stakes bingo, poker rooms, blackjack, mini-baccarat, electronic Roulette, Mississippi Stud, Ultimate Texas Hold’em, Three Card Poker, and more. The state also allows pari-mutuel-style casinos (cardrooms) at race tracks (racinos).

Cruise ships that leave Florida waters for international waters are legal.

Florida Gambling History

In 1931 the Florida legislature voted to approve horse and dog racing legalization. Although Gov. Doyle Carlton attempted to veto the vote, he was overridden. Florida legalized Jai alai and slot machines in 1935. At the end of December 2020, Florida voters decided to end greyhound racing in the state.

In 1970 bingo was legalized. Later that same decade, in 1978, attempts for a full-blown casino gambling constitutional amendment was rejected. After opposing a limit on bingo games in Florida a year later, the Seminole tribe opened a high-stakes bingo hall in Broward County.

In 1986, voters again rejected an attempt for a full-scale casino gambling amendment to the constitution. That year was not all gloom for Florida gambling, as voters did approve the legalization of a state lottery that began operating in 1988.

The 1988 passing of the Indian Gaming Regulatory Act legalizing native tribal gambling led to the installation of video lottery machines. In 1989 poker rooms were built on Indian lands. On April 7, 2010, Florida signed a Gaming Compact with the Seminole Tribe.

Legalized poker became available at pari-mutuel facilities with parts of no more than $10 in 1996. Poker room bet limits were raised to a maximum of $2 in 2003, then $5 in 2007. In 2010 the limits on bets, pots, and tournaments were removed.

Florida has allowed land-based gambling since 2004. But it’s not without limitations. Casinos in the state are permitted, provided they don’t offer sports betting. Slot machines at pari-mutuel facilities in Broward and Miami–Dade were allowed after a constitutional amendment narrowly passed in 2004.

Meanwhile, the federal law changed in 2018 to allow states to permit their residents to gamble online. Florida is, to date, not one of the states that has allowed casino gambling in the wake of this decision, so online gambling remains out of reach for players in the state.

Florida Gambling FAQ

Does Florida have land-based casinos?

Florida has 25 racetrack casinos that offer pari-mutuel-style casinos (poker rooms) and 7 Tribal Casinos offering opportunities for gambling in Florida.

Has Florida legalized fantasy sports and daily fantasy sports?

Fantasy sports and daily fantasy sports for money are not legal in Florida. No regulations exist for FS/DFS in the state. They are, however not treated as Florida gambling and therefore aren’t strictly illegal, being a different case from sports betting or outright gambling in Florida

Does Florida offer state/interstate lotteries?

Yes, Florida legalized lotteries in 1986 and has grown to include 13,000 authorized lottery retailers.

Is sports betting legal at Florida online gambling sites?

No, neither land-based nor online sports betting is legal in Florida. Nor are online casinos

What forms of gambling in Florida are legal?

Florida legally allows Seminole casinos, pari-mutuel-style casinos, charity gaming, and lotteries.

What is the legal gambling age in Florida?

The legal Florida gambling age depends on the game type. Although charitable gaming and lotteries require players to be 18+, racinos, pari-mutuel horse racing, and casinos require players to be 21+.
